ChatGPT建造设计:全面指南与常见问题解答

1. 什么是ChatGPT建造设计

ChatGPT建造设计是指通过构建和训练模型来定制自己的聊天机器人,使其具备特定的语言交互能力。这个过程涉及选择合适的数据集、模型架构设计、超参数调整等步骤。

2. ChatGPT建造设计的基本概念

2.1 自然语言处理(NLP)

自然语言处理是指计算机科学、人工智能和语言学等领域的交叉学科,研究如何实现计算机与人类自然语言之间的有效通信。

2.2 深度学习

深度学习是机器学习的一个分支,通过模仿人脑的结构和功能,实现对数据的建模和学习。

2.3 ChatGPT

ChatGPT是一种基于Transformer架构的自然语言处理模型,由OpenAI开发。它能够生成逼真的文本,被广泛用于聊天机器人的开发。

3. ChatGPT建造设计流程

3.1 数据收集与预处理

  • 确定聊天机器人的应用场景和目标用户群体
  • 收集相关的对话数据集
  • 清洗、标记和预处理数据

3.2 模型选择与架构设计

  • 选择合适的ChatGPT模型版本和规模
  • 设计模型架构,包括层数、注意力头数等

3.3 训练与调优

  • 划分训练集、验证集和测试集
  • 进行模型训练,并根据验证集结果调整超参数

4. ChatGPT建造设计的关键步骤

4.1 确定应用场景

在开始建造设计之前,首先要明确聊天机器人的应用场景,例如客服对话、虚拟助手等。

4.2 数据收集与清洗

选择合适的数据集,并进行清洗和预处理,以保证模型训练的质量和效果。

4.3 模型训练与调优

通过在数据集上进行模型训练,并根据验证集的表现对模型进行调优,以提高聊天机器人的交互效果。

5. ChatGPT建造设计的最佳实践

5.1 多样化数据集

尽量使用多样化的对话数据集,以覆盖不同场景和语境,提升聊天机器人的适用范围。

5.2 模型评估与迭代

持续对聊天机器人进行模型评估,并根据用户反馈不断迭代优化,以提升用户体验。

常见问题FAQ

1. ChatGPT建造设计需要哪些技术基础?

建议具备以下技术基础:

  • 自然语言处理基础
  • Python编程基础
  • 深度学习框架(如PyTorch、TensorFlow)的基础

2. ChatGPT建造设计的训练时间一般需要多久?

训练时间取决于数据集规模、模型规模、硬件设备等因素,一般来说需要数小时到数天不等。

3. 如何评估ChatGPT建造设计的效果?

可以通过人工评估和自动评估两种方式进行。人工评估可以通过实际对话测试,自动评估可以通过BLEU、Perplexity等指标进行评估。

正文完